Listing below the 5 common problems with tyres: Overinflation : One of the most common problems with car tyres is too much pressure. This causes the tyre to not perform efficiently and causes inconvenience during commute. Over-inflation of pressure is when the centre of the tyre is noticeable. This results in the car running only on the inner edge of the tyre where the outer edges of the tyre will refrain from contacting the road’s surface. Under inflation: Under inflation is a common problem with car tyres and causes tyre failure. When the tyre pressure is low, its surface area that touches the road increases. The increased footprint, if left unattended, will increase friction, which can cause overheating. Under inflation increases tyre wear, creates excessive heat and causes the sidewalls to overflex. Bulging tyre problem: Bulges in a tyre are usually a result of impact damage which includes hitting a pothole, curb, or cracks on the road that can damage the structure of tyres. Tyre sidewalls are built to tolerate harsh treatment but if the tyre isn’t maintained properly, it can result in a bulge. Driving up curbs to park, for example, can result in irreversible tyre damage and requires the tyre to be replaced.
